Наследование: Toggl.Joey.UI.Fragments.BaseDialogFragment
 private void OnCreateButtonClicked(object sender, DialogClickEventArgs args)
 {
     CreateClientDialogFragment.NewInstance(WorkspaceId)
     .SetOnClientSelectedListener(clientSelectedHandler)
     .Show(FragmentManager, "new_client_dialog");
     Dismiss();
 }
        public static CreateClientDialogFragment NewInstance (Guid workspaceId)
        {
            var fragment = new CreateClientDialogFragment ();

            var args = new Bundle();
            args.PutString (WorkspaceIdArgument, workspaceId.ToString ());
            fragment.Arguments = args;

            return fragment;
        }
        public static CreateClientDialogFragment NewInstance(Guid workspaceId)
        {
            var fragment = new CreateClientDialogFragment();

            var args = new Bundle();

            args.PutString(WorkspaceIdArgument, workspaceId.ToString());
            fragment.Arguments = args;

            return(fragment);
        }
Пример #4
0
 private async void SelectClientBitClickedHandler(object sender, EventArgs e)
 {
     if (await ClientListViewModel.ContainsClients(WorkspaceId))
     {
         ClientListDialogFragment.NewInstance(WorkspaceId)
         .SetClientSelectListener(this)
         .Show(FragmentManager, "clients_dialog");
     }
     else
     {
         CreateClientDialogFragment.NewInstance(WorkspaceId)
         .SetOnClientSelectedListener(this)
         .Show(FragmentManager, "new_client_dialog");
     }
 }